About Lavender

Lavender is a complex multi-race indica from Sensi Seeds, combining genetics from Afghani, Hawaiian, Korean, Mexican, and Afghan strains. The name comes from the distinctive lavender floral notes in the aroma alongside the classic indica earthiness. The high is among the most deeply sedating available — a true couch-lock stone that melts stress and anxiety.

History

Lavender was bred by Sensi Seeds in Amsterdam in the early 1990s as a demonstration of their multi-race indica breeding programme. The complexity of its genetics — five distinct landrace sources — is remarkable for a commercial strain. The lavender floral character comes primarily from the Hawaiian genetics in its background. Sensi Seeds won multiple Cannabis Cups with this variety.

Notable breeders: Sensi Seeds

What is the THC content of Lavender?

Lavender typically tests at 15-20% THC with <1% CBD.

How long does Lavender take to flower?

Lavender has a flowering time of approximately 8-10 weeks. Plants grow to a short to medium height.
